Curis Reports Fourth Quarter and Year-End 2015 Financial Results
February 29, 2016 7:00 AM ESTLEXINGTON, Mass., Feb. 29, 2016 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Curis, Inc. (NASDAQ: CRIS), a biotechnology company focused on the development and commercialization of innovative drug candidates for the treatment of human cancers, today reported its financial results for the fourth quarter and year ended December 31, 2015.
"2015 has been a year of significant milestones for Curis, said Ali Fattaey, Ph.D., Curis' President and CEO.
